Active Genes
Sections of DNA that are being transcribed and translated into proteins, influencing the traits of an organism.
Heterochromatin
A tightly packed form of DNA, which is transcriptionally inactive, aiding in maintaining the DNA's structural integrity.
Euchromatin
A lightly packed form of chromatin (DNA, RNA, and protein complex) that is enriched in gene concentration and is active in transcription.
Barr Bodies
Inactivated X chromosomes found in the nuclei of cells in female organisms, visible as a dense mass, and a key component in dosage compensation.
